Daniel Cormier’s UFC Fight Purses and Bonuses

DateEventOpponentResultBase SalaryWin BonusPerformance BonusTotal
3 May 2014UFC 173Dan HendersonWin$90,000$90,000$50,000$230,000
3 Jan 2015UFC 182Jon JonesLoss$90,000$0$0$90,000
23 May 2015UFC 187Anthony JohnsonWin$90,000$90,000$0$180,000
3 Oct 2015UFC 192Alexander GustafssonWin$150,000$150,000$50,000$350,000
23 Jul 2016UFC 200Anderson SilvaWin$500,000$0$0$500,000
4 Nov 2016UFC 210Anthony Johnson IIWin$600,000$0$0$600,000
29 Jul 2017UFC 214Jon Jones IILoss$1,000,000$0$0$1,000,000
20 Jan 2018UFC 220Volkan OezdemirWin$500,000$0$50,000$550,000
7 Jul 2018UFC 226Stipe MiocicWin$500,000$0$50,000$550,000
2 Mar 2019UFC 235Derrick LewisWin$640,000$0$0$640,000
17 Aug 2019UFC 241Stipe Miocic IILoss$500,000$0$0$500,000
15 Aug 2020UFC 252Stipe Miocic IIILoss$1,040,000$0$0$1,040,000
Daniel Cormier net worth

The table shows that he earned a total of $6.73 million from 12 fights in the UFC, with his highest payout being $1.04 million for his last fight against Stipe Miocic.

Daniel Cormier’s Early Life and Wrestling Background

Daniel Cormier excelled in high school, college wrestling & olympics winning numerous championship titles.
Daniel Cormier at the Olympic

Daniel Cormier, a renowned American mixed martial artist, was born in Lafayette, Louisiana on March 20, 1979. Growing up in a large family of seven, raised by his single mother after his father was killed when he was just seven years old.

At the age of ten, Cormier discovered wrestling through his older brother who was also a wrestler. He quickly excelled in high school and college wrestling winning numerous championship titles.

After completing high school in 1997, Cormier attended Oklahoma State University on a wrestling scholarship and remained competitive until graduation with a degree in sociology in 2001.

Thereafter, he pursued freestyle wrestling representing the United States at the 2004 and 2008 Olympics while clinching top podium positions such as bronze medal at the World Championships held in Beijing (2007) and gold medal at Pan American Games hosted by Santo Domingo (2003), among many other accomplishments with distinction.

Remarkably appointed captain of the U.S. Olympic wrestling team in 2008 but had to withdraw from competition due to kidney failure caused by excessive weight cutting – an unfortunate challenge faced by many athletes that requires careful management for both health and performance reasons.

Transitioning to MMA

Daniel Cormier made the transition to mixed martial arts in 2009 and trained at the American Kickboxing Academy.
Daniel Cormier made the transition to mixed martial arts in 2009 and trained at the American Kickboxing Academy

The transition from Olympic wrestling to MMA was a natural progression for Daniel Cormier, who utilized his grappling skills to become a dominant force in the sport.

Daniel Cormier made the transition to mixed martial arts in 2009 and found a new home at the American Kickboxing Academy in San Jose.

There, Cormier worked with other top-notch fighters like Cain Velasquez and Josh Thompson under the direction of coach Javier Mendez.

With his wrestling background as a foundation, Cormier honed his striking skills while fighting in various amateur competitions.

His debut in Strikeforce’s heavyweight grand prix marked a turning point for his career, and he eventually emerged victorious from the tournament, landing him a coveted contract with the UFC.

Daniel Cormier’s Major Accomplishments in MMA

Winning Strikeforce Heavyweight Grand Prix in 2011

In 2011, Daniel Cormier made a significant mark in his MMA career by winning the Strikeforce Heavyweight Grand Prix tournament.

He joined as an alternate and defeated some of the best fighters in the heavyweight division such as Antonio Silva and Josh Barnett to emerge victorious.

This led to him being recognized as one of the rising stars in MMA. Following this accomplishment, Cormier signed with UFC and continued his unbeaten run in heavyweight fights, defeating former champions Frank Mir and Roy Nelson.

The victory in Strikeforce helped catapult Cormier’s career into the limelight and established him as one of the top fighters to watch out for in subsequent years.

UFC Light Heavyweight Champion from 2014 to 2018

Daniel Cormier became the UFC Light Heavyweight Champion in 2014 and defended his title against top contenders
Daniel Cormier became the UFC Light Heavyweight Champion in 2014

Cormier made a move to light heavyweight in 2014, where he faced Jon Jones for the championship at UFC 182 but ultimately lost by unanimous decision, inflicting his maiden loss in MMA.

Nevertheless, Cormier avenged his defeat with a submission victory versus Anthony Johnson in UFC 187, propelling him as the new light heavyweight titleholder.

He defended his belt against Alexander Gustafsson, Anderson Silva and again Johnson before losing it to Jones through KO in UFC 214.

However, Jones tested positive for illicit drug use thereafter rendering him ineligible as champion, which prompted Cormier’s reclamation of the title.

Throughout his time spent as the Light Heavyweight champion of MMA, Cormier solidified himself as one of its most dominant competitors ever; his mastery over grappling alongside an illustrious wrestling background made him an intimidating presence for any challenger on the Octagon.

Daniel Cormier: Reigning as UFC Heavyweight Champion (2018-2019)

 A picture of Daniel Cormier celebrating after winning the UFC Heavyweight Championship
Daniel Cormier celebrating after winning the UFC Heavyweight Championship

Cormier then became a two-division champion by moving back up to heavyweight (265 lbs) and knocking out Stipe Miocic at UFC 226, becoming only the second fighter in UFC history to hold two titles simultaneously.

He defended his heavyweight title against Derrick Lewis at UFC 230, before losing it to Miocic in a rematch at UFC 241.

He attempted to regain his title in a trilogy fight with Miocic at UFC 252, but lost by unanimous decision. He announced his retirement in the octagon after the fight, saying “I’m not interested in fighting for anything but titles, and I don’t imagine there’s going to be a title in the future, so that’ll be it for me.”
